Meaning ● Intuition and Analytics Balance, within the SMB context, represents the strategic equilibrium between data-driven insights and experienced judgment, crucial for informed decision-making. In the pursuit of SMB growth, this balance dictates how automation initiatives are prioritized and implemented. Often, SMBs must make quick pivots in the face of limited resources; therefore, understanding when to trust quantitative data versus leveraging experiential knowledge is critical. It’s the art of combining predictive analysis with gut feelings refined over time, acknowledging that while analytics reveal trends, intuition can spot opportunities or risks analytics might miss. Strategic intelligence comes into play when weighing potential technological upgrades with their real-world impact on team dynamics and business processes. A firm understanding of the market, coupled with reliable data analysis and the ability to read between the numbers helps to create the best business direction. For successful SMB growth, trusting both data and your intuition is fundamental.
